St. Mary Medical Center, a member of Trinity Health Mid-Atlantic, is looking for a Registered Nurse to join our Float Team in Critical Care.
Schedule: Full Time, 36 hours weekly, Night Shift
The primary objective of this position is to improve quality. Responsible for the direct and/or indirect care of patients assigned utilizing professional nursing skills and knowledge.
+ Assesses learning needs, readiness to learn and identify actual or potential barriers to learning and thereby incorporating the patient's education into daily activities based on age, cultural and spiritual values.
+ Documents admission assessment / reassessment, plan, interventions and medication use and monitors its effects and outcomes according to policy.
+ Utilizes the information management system to enhance communication and documents change in-patients condition to all appropriate individuals. Prioritizes work assignment based on changing situations.
+ Communicates transfer of patient responsibility and pertinent information at the bedside and during Interprofessional Rounds
+ Recognizes and integrates patient special needs and individualizes care and knowledgeable in abuse recognition and referral
+ Includes pain management and supportive care issues in the plan of care.
+ Adheres to infection control standards specific to patient care and by promotes and maintains a safe, clean and orderly environment.
+ Performs other duties as assigned.
Requirements** **:
+ PA RN License
+ ASN required, BSN preferred
+ BLS, ACLS, PALS
+ Minimum of 3 years critical care experience
